Interior angles. the interior angles of a triangle are the angles inside the triangle. properties of interior angles. the sum of the three interior angles in a triangle is always 180°. since the interior angles add up to 180°, every angle must be less than 180°. find missing angles inside a triangle. example: find the value of x in the. Example 2: right triangle. find the measure of the unknown angle labeled b in the following triangle: add up the angles that are given within the triangle. show step. the angles 90 ∘ 90∘ and 19 ∘ 19∘ are given. add these together: 90 19 = 109 ∘ 90 19 = 109∘. subtract this total from 180 ∘.180∘. show step.
